What is the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report?

The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report is a crucial form in the realm of campaign finance, particularly in Geomia. This document serves the essential purpose of reporting campaign contributions and expenditures, ensuring transparency within political processes. Candidates, chairpersons, and treasurers are required to complete this form to maintain compliance with state regulations.
Understanding this report is vital for anyone involved in campaign finance as it facilitates proper accountability and tracking of funds. The accurate completion of this report helps uphold the integrity of the electoral process in Geomia.

Who is Required to File the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report?

Eligibility to file the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report in Geomia primarily includes candidates, chairpersons, and treasurers associated with campaign committees. Each role carries specific responsibilities that are crucial for accurate reporting.
  • Candidates are responsible for reporting their own contributions and expenditures.
  • Chairpersons oversee the reporting process and ensure compliance with campaign finance laws.
  • Treasurers manage the financial aspects, keeping detailed records to support the report.
While these roles are standard, certain exceptions may apply under Geomia law, which can influence who must file.

Candidates, chairpersons, and treasurers involved in political campaigns in Geomia are eligible to submit the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report to ensure transparency in campaign financing.
The deadline for submitting the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report typically aligns with campaign finance regulations in Geomia. Ensure you check the specific election calendar for accurate due dates related to your campaign.
You can submit the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report through the designated state election office portal, by mail, or as instructed on the form after it has been completed and notarized.
You may need to attach receipts, statements, or evidence of contributions along with the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report. Ensure all documents are accurate and submitted together to avoid processing delays.
Avoid incomplete fields, incorrect financial reporting, and missing the notarization requirement. Double-check all entries for accuracy to prevent issues with compliance.
Processing times for the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report can vary. Generally, it may take a few weeks to be processed, so file early to address any potential issues.
Yes, notarization is required for the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Report to ensure the information provided is legally verified and accurately reflects your campaign's financial activities.
